displaytag IS jsp 1.1 compatible and ships with 2 different tlds, a 1.1 and a 1.2 version.
What problem did you see? Why the JspException use should not be jsp 1.1 compatible?

About the JspException, DisplayTag are using the "public JspException(String message, Throwable rootCause)"
constructor that I think that it's servlet 2.3+ compatible [http://java.sun.com/products/servlet/2.2/javadoc/].
